Carthage, Texas is a small yet vibrant city located in the eastern part of the state. With a population of just over 6,500, Carthage offers a charming and close-knit community that values its rich history and heritage. The city is the county seat of Panola County and has a relaxed, Southern atmosphere that captures the essence of small-town living in Texas.

Carthage is known for its beautiful and well-preserved historic downtown area, which features numerous buildings and homes dating back to the late 19th and early 20th centuries. Visitors can take a stroll through the streets lined with quaint shops, restaurants, and local businesses that add to the city’s character and charm.

One of the standout attractions in Carthage is the Texas Country Music Hall of Fame, which pays homage to the state’s country music legends and showcases memorabilia, artifacts, and exhibits that celebrate the genre’s rich history. The hall of fame also hosts live music events and concerts, drawing in locals and visitors alike.

Nature enthusiasts will appreciate the city’s proximity to the Sabine National Forest, a vast and lush area that offers numerous outdoor activities such as hiking, fishing, and camping. The nearby Murvaul Creek Lake provides opportunities for boating and water sports, making it an ideal destination for those who enjoy spending time in the great outdoors.

Carthage also hosts several annual events and festivals that bring the community together. The East Texas Oil and Gas Blast, held in downtown Carthage, celebrates the city’s rich history in the oil industry with live music, food vendors, and a car show. The Texas Country Music Hall of Fame also hosts a variety of events throughout the year, including concerts, songwriter competitions, and music workshops.

In addition to its cultural and recreational offerings, Carthage is also home to a strong local economy, supported by a mix of manufacturing, agriculture, and small businesses.
